What are the most common dermatology services available at clinics serving Lecontes Mills residents?

Dermatology practices in the region, such as those in Clearfield, typically offer comprehensive skin cancer screenings (especially important for those with outdoor lifestyles), treatment for acne and rosacea, management of eczema and psoriasis, and minor surgical procedures like mole removals. Many also provide cosmetic services, including treatment for sun damage and aging skin, which are common concerns in our rural Pennsylvania community.

A dermatologist specializing in hair loss will begin with a thorough evaluation to pinpoint the exact cause. Common diagnoses include androgenetic alopecia (pattern hair loss), alopecia areata (an autoimmune condition), telogen effluvium (often triggered by stress or illness), or conditions like seborrheic dermatitis exacerbated by climate changes. They will examine your scalp, possibly using a tool called a dermatoscope, and discuss your health history, diet, and routines. This diagnostic precision is vital because an effective treatment plan for genetic pattern loss will differ greatly from one for a thyroid-related issue or a scalp infection.

The good news is that modern dermatology offers a range of effective treatments for hair loss. After a diagnosis, your specialist may discuss options such as FDA-approved topical medications, oral prescriptions, in-office procedures like corticosteroid injections for patchy loss, or advanced treatments like platelet-rich plasma (PRP) therapy. They can also provide guidance on proper scalp care for our local climate and recommend nutritional adjustments. The goal is to not only address active hair loss but also to promote the health of existing hair and encourage regrowth where possible.
